Indlela Eyenziwa Ngayo I-Polyurethane Foam

I-polyurethane foam iveliswa ngokusebenzisa i-chemical reaction phakathi kwe-diisocyanates kunye ne-polyols, zombini ezithathwe kwi-oyile ekrwada, nangona ii-polyols zinokwenziwa kwi-oyile yendalo ehlaziyekayo. Le reaction iphumela kwi-polymer chain eyenza isakhiwo esiphambili se-foam. Imveliso ye-polyurethane foam ibandakanya izinto ezintandathu eziphambili:

- IiPolyols: Ibhloko yokwakha ephambili yefoam, esabela kunye ne-diisocyanates.

- Ii-Diisocyanates: Ii-reactants eziphambili ezidityaniswe nee-polyols ukwenza i-foam.

- Iiarhente zokufaka amagwebu: Ezi zinceda ekwakheni ulwakhiwo lweseli lwefoam.

- Ii-surfactants: Zinzisa igwebu ngexesha lenkqubo yalo yokwandisa.

- Iikhatalyst: Khawulezisa impendulo phakathi kweepolyols kunye neediisocyanates, uqinisekise ukwakheka kwefoam okufanelekileyo.

- Izixhobo zokulungisa izinto: Ii-Crosslinkers kunye nee-chain extenders zisetyenziselwa ukuphucula ukuqina nokusebenza kwe-foam.

Xa ezi zithako zidityanisiwe, ziyasabela ngokweekhemikhali, zivelise ubushushu, igesi, kunye nolwakhiwo olubonakalayo lwefoam. IiCatalysts ezifana neMXC-A33 yethu kunye neMXC-T zenza kube lula oku kusabela, ziqinisekisa inkqubo elawulwayo nesebenzayo.

Izicelo zeCatalyst kwiPolyurethane Foam

I-polyurethane foam iza kwiindidi ezimbini eziphambili: eqinileyo neguquguqukayo. Ukusetyenziswa kwayo kususela ekugqumeni ubushushu xa kusakhiwa (i-rigid foam) ukuya ekutshiseni ifenitshala kunye nangaphakathi kweemoto (i-flexible foam). Ii-catalysts zethu zenzelwe iimfuno ezahlukeneyo:

-I-MXC-A33:I-catalyst eyenziwe yi-33% TEDA (triphenylenediamine) kunye ne-67% DPG (monoconjugated dipropylene glycol), eyenzelwe ngokukodwa ii-polyurethane foams kunye ne-polyurethane elastomers. Isetyenziswa kakhulu kwi-polyurethane foam ethambileyo, eqina, eqinileyo, kunye ne-elastomer.

-I-MXC-T:Yi-catalyst ye-amine esebenzayo, engenazo izisi ezikhupha umoya enika i-reaction curve egudileyo kwaye ngenxa yoko ingasetyenziselwa ukuvelisa iintlobo ezahlukeneyo ze-polyurethane foams. Isenzo sayo sokuvuselela sikhuthaza i-reaction ye-urea (water-isocyanate), enokuthambekela ekuphenduleni kwi-polymer matrix ngenxa yeqela layo elisebenzayo le-hydroxyl. Ngenxa yesi sizathu, i-TMAEA isetyenziselwa ukutshiza i-foam insulation, ii-dashboards zeemoto, kunye nezinye iindawo ezifuna ivumba elincinci elishiyekileyo..

Iikhatalyst zePolyurethane ziqinisekisa amazinga afanelekileyo okusabela, iimpawu zefoam ezilungelelaniswe kakuhle ezifana noxinano, ubulukhuni, kunye nokuqina kwesakhiwo. Oku kuchaneka kwenza ifoam ye-polyurethane ikwazi ukuhlangabezana neemfuno ezingqongqo zemizi-mveliso yanamhlanje, kubandakanya ulwakhiwo, iimoto, ifenitshala kunye nokupakishwa.
